Cast vs Forged Valve Bodies - Engineering Comparison, Applications and When to Specify Each

The choice between a cast valve body (shaped by pouring molten metal into a mould) and a forged valve body (shaped by pressing or hammering heated metal billet under high pressure) affects mechanical strength, size range, lead time, cost, and the applicable design standard.

Pressure Seal Bonnet Gate Valves: Class 900–2500 Selection Guide | API 600 | Vajra

Pressure seal bonnet gate valves use internal pressure to increase sealing force - making them the preferred design for Class 900–2500 high-pressure steam, feedwater, and hydrogen service where bolted bonnets become impractical.
